Type status: holotype. Geological context: Tertiary, Polecat Bench Fm. Collection locality: Big Horn County, Wyoming, USA. Collected by Albert C. Silberling, 1951. distal end left tibiotarsus; distal end right tibiotarsus; proximal & distal ends left tarsometarsus; distal end right tarsometarsus; misc. bone scrap ["Distal ends of left and right tibiotarsi, proximal end of left tarsometarsus, and distal ends of left and right tarsometatrsi, other scraps of bone; VP PU number 16179; lot count 1; accn=VPPUA.00285.
